Torben Schulz is the founder and COO of Rows, a platform that allows users to create applications using only spreadsheet skills. Of course, not everyone can code, but everyone knows how to use a spreadsheet. From that idea, Rows was made. Its user-friendly interface as a web app makes it easier for people to automate data, create reports, enrich spreadsheets, and other functions. It is a server-based spreadsheet with integrations and web requests. Their mission at Rows is to make things efficient for the user to become more productive. Torben tells how this upgrade from existing spreadsheet software earned them 30,000 users in less than eight months.  Show Notes [00:40] An upgraded spreadsheet for the business-minded [04:30] A horizontal productivity tool in contrast with its vertical counterpart [09:35] Use cases: should you tackle things one at a time or all at once?
